What Are Conex Containers?
Conex containers are big, standardized steel boxes created for the transport of products across various modes of transport, consisting of ships, trains, and trucks. The term "Conex" originates from "Container Express," which was at first a military term used to explain these containers. They come in various sizes, the most typical being the 20-foot and 40-foot variations.
Table 1: Standard Sizes of Conex ContainersContainer SizeExternal Dimensions (Feet)Internal Dimensions (Feet)Volume (Cubic Feet)Weight (Empty)20 feet20 x 8 x 8.519.4 x 7.7 x 7.91,1694,850 pounds40 ft40 x 8 x 8.539.5 x 7.7 x 7.92,3858,000 lbs40 ft High Cube40 x 8 x 9.539.5 x 7.7 x 8.92,6948,500 poundsDevelopment of Conex Containers
The concept of intermodal shipping containers emerged in the 1950s, spearheaded by Malcolm McLean, a trucker who sought to enhance loading and unloading effectiveness at ports. The standardization of container sizes allowed for much easier transport and managing across different transport systems, considerably improving shipping effectiveness and minimizing costs.
Secret Milestones in Container Development1956: First commercial usage of shipping containers by Malcolm McLean.1961: The International Organization for Standardization (ISO) sets requirements for container sizes.1980s: Global trade booms, further popularizing shipping containers.2000s: Emergence of modified containers for non-traditional uses such as housing and offices.Applications of Conex Containers
The adaptability of Conex containers extends beyond shipping. Their intrinsic resilience and versatility have led to various ingenious applications throughout various markets:
1. Storage Solutions
Conex containers offer safe and secure storage for companies and individuals. Their tough construction secures contents from natural components, theft, and vandalism.
2. Construction Sites
On construction sites, these containers serve dual purposes: as storage units for tools and materials and as short-term workplaces or workstations.
3. Housing
Over the last few years, shipping containers have actually acquired traction as a sustainable structure option. They are progressively used to develop economical housing, emergency shelters, and even special getaway rentals.
4. Mobile Businesses
Entrepreneurs have accepted the trend of using Conex containers as mobile storefronts, cafés, and food trucks. Their mobility permits simple relocation based upon customer demand or seasonal trends.
5. Military Applications
Conex containers are thoroughly made use of in military operations. They serve as transport systems for personnel, equipment, and supplies, often repurposed into living quarters or command centers.
6. Eco-Friendly Initiatives
With a growing emphasis on sustainability, Conex containers are being repurposed into green spaces, community gardens, and metropolitan farms, including worth to ecological efforts.

The popularity of Conex containers across markets can be attributed to their many advantages:

Cost-Effective: Compared to traditional construction and storage solutions, Conex containers are reasonably inexpensive. The low preliminary financial investment and resilience make them cost-efficient.

Sturdiness: Made from weather-resistant steel, Conex containers can endure extreme conditions, making them appropriate for numerous environments.

Mobility: Their modular design provides itself to fast transport and relocation, especially helpful for businesses needing flexibility.

Sustainability: Utilizing Conex containers for construction or storage promotes recycling and resource conservation.

Customizability: Containers can be modified to fulfill specific requirements, whether for insulation, ventilation, or aesthetic purposes.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)Q1: Are Conex containers water resistant?
A: While shipping containers are normally water-resistant, their watertight nature can be jeopardized. For long-lasting storage or particular applications, extra sealing may be required.
Q2: Can Conex containers be stacked?
A: Yes, Conex containers are developed to be stacked, allowing for effective usage of area. Nevertheless, weight restrictions must be observed to make sure structural stability.
Q3: How can I modify a Conex container for living functions?
A: Modifications consist of adding insulation, windows, electrical systems, plumbing, and interior partitions. Consulting with a professional is recommended for comprehensive renovations.
Q4: Do I require an unique permit to put a Conex container on my property?
A: Regulations vary by location. It's a good idea to consult local authorities or zoning boards to ensure compliance before putting a container on your residential or commercial property.
Q5: What upkeep is needed for Conex containers?
A: Routine maintenance consists of looking for rust, guaranteeing seals are undamaged, and checking structural integrity. Routine cleansing assists extend the lifespan of the container.
